About ZIP Code 95127

ZIP code 95127 is located in San Jose, California, within Santa Clara County. With a population of 61,091, this is a densely populated ZIP code with a middle-aged community — the median age is 39 years. Economically, 95127 is a upper-middle-income ZIP code: the median household income of $120,548 is significantly above the national average.

Real estate in ZIP code 95127 represents among the most expensive housing markets in the country. The median home value of $995,100 is more than double the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$2,549 per month in median rent. Homeownership is strong here — 65.7% of occupied units are owner-occupied, suggesting an established, stable residential community. Median home values have increased by 44% since 2019.

The population of 95127 is majority Hispanic (54.47%). Residents are moderately educated — 38.6%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is near the national average. Poverty affects a relatively small share of residents at 8.8%. Household income has grown by 22% since 2019.

The unemployment rate in 95127 stands at 5.9%, which is above the national average. About 11% of workers are remote. As in most parts of the country, driving alone is the dominant commute mode at 71%.
